Shabinder / SpotiFlyer

Kotlin Multiplatform Music Downloader, Supports Spotify / Gaana / Youtube Music / Jio Saavn / SoundCloud.
https://app.spotiflyer.in/
GNU General Public License v3.0
10.43k stars 780 forks source link

[BUG] : Unable to connect to Internet #3415

Open Cyclopropinon opened 9 months ago

Cyclopropinon commented 9 months ago

Describe the bug: spotiflyer fails to open any links. Spotify, Youtube. Small Error Box appears: grafik On my browser (Firefox as well as Links2) I can open both Youtube & Spotify ==> I have Internet connection. Last year when I have been using this app, it worked fine. After a few months of not using it, I now decided to use it again, and it doesnt work anymore.

Media Links Used: https://open.spotify.com/playlist/1JLw7Y5YvlsA10XjaKHTxE https://www.youtube.com/watch?v=Zwh40iLEl0Q (also tried with a ton of other links. too much to dig up and paste here)

Expected behavior Load the Link and show the Download Menu.

Screenshots:

StackTrace:

Debug: (Kermit) Requesting New Token
[MVIKotlin]: Main thread id is undefined, main thread assert is disabled
io.ktor.client.features.ClientRequestException: Client request(https://open.spotify.com/) invalid: 429 Too Many Requests. Text: ""
    at io.ktor.client.features.DefaultResponseValidationKt$addDefaultResponseValidation$1$1.invokeSuspend(DefaultResponseValidation.kt:47)
    at io.ktor.client.features.DefaultResponseValidationKt$addDefaultResponseValidation$1$1.invoke(DefaultResponseValidation.kt)
    at io.ktor.client.features.DefaultResponseValidationKt$addDefaultResponseValidation$1$1.invoke(DefaultResponseValidation.kt)
    at io.ktor.client.features.HttpCallValidator.validateResponse(HttpCallValidator.kt:54)
    at io.ktor.client.features.HttpCallValidator.access$validateResponse(HttpCallValidator.kt:33)
    at io.ktor.client.features.HttpCallValidator$Companion$install$3.invokeSuspend(HttpCallValidator.kt:133)
    at io.ktor.client.features.HttpCallValidator$Companion$install$3.invoke(HttpCallValidator.kt)
    at io.ktor.client.features.HttpCallValidator$Companion$install$3.invoke(HttpCallValidator.kt)
    at io.ktor.client.features.HttpSend$Feature$install$1.invokeSuspend(HttpSend.kt:96)
    at kotlin.coroutines.jvm.internal.BaseContinuationImpl.resumeWith(ContinuationImpl.kt:33)
    at io.ktor.util.pipeline.SuspendFunctionGun.resumeRootWith(SuspendFunctionGun.kt:191)
    at io.ktor.util.pipeline.SuspendFunctionGun.loop(SuspendFunctionGun.kt:147)
    at io.ktor.util.pipeline.SuspendFunctionGun.access$loop(SuspendFunctionGun.kt:15)
    at io.ktor.util.pipeline.SuspendFunctionGun$continuation$1.resumeWith(SuspendFunctionGun.kt:93)
    at kotlin.coroutines.jvm.internal.BaseContinuationImpl.resumeWith(ContinuationImpl.kt:46)
    at kotlinx.coroutines.DispatchedTask.run(DispatchedTask.kt:106)
    at kotlinx.coroutines.internal.LimitedDispatcher.run(LimitedDispatcher.kt:39)
    at kotlinx.coroutines.scheduling.TaskImpl.run(Tasks.kt:95)
    at kotlinx.coroutines.scheduling.CoroutineScheduler.runSafely(CoroutineScheduler.kt:571)
    at kotlinx.coroutines.scheduling.CoroutineScheduler$Worker.executeTask(CoroutineScheduler.kt:750)
    at kotlinx.coroutines.scheduling.CoroutineScheduler$Worker.runWorker(CoroutineScheduler.kt:678)
    at kotlinx.coroutines.scheduling.CoroutineScheduler$Worker.run(CoroutineScheduler.kt:665)
Debug: (Kermit) Spotify Auth Failed: Please Check your Network Connection

Device Info (please complete the following information):

bastifpv commented 8 months ago

Have the same issue

tcntad commented 8 months ago

Same issue here as well

AceNagata commented 7 months ago

same issue here

Habbut commented 6 months ago

same issue with

tropisch commented 3 months ago

got the same problem